Any ideas on this one? I've searched all over but no fix yet.
I use a thermal label printer for shipping. If if I use that printer in Firefox, the label paper profile is 'stuck' and any other printer selected in Firefox thinks that the label stock is the paper profile. I can reset the printers in Firefox config and all is well until I use that thermal printer again.
I can set up a separate Firefox profile for just that printer but that's not a good work-around!
I'm stuck..just Iike that label profile!

Click the menu button. , click Help and select More Troubleshooting Information. The Troubleshooting Information page with the address about:support will open in a new tab.
Go down to the Printing section and click Clear saved print settings.

I found that opening the task manager, [ Ctrl-Alt-Delete ]and stopping the print spooler, then restarting it, often fixes may odd printer issues.
